Visual Analysis of the Tattoo

This striking tattoo depicts the ancient symbol of the Ouroboros – a serpent or dragon devouring its own tail. The image forms a perfect infinity symbol, showcasing a continuous loop of creation and destruction. The artist has meticulously rendered the scales of the serpent, adding depth and texture to the design. The head of the serpent is detailed and expressive, conveying a sense of wisdom and power. The placement on the forearm allows for a prominent display of this symbolic artwork.

Artistic Style and Technical Execution

The style is realism with a touch of illustrative flair. The artist demonstrates mastery of shading techniques, creating a three-dimensional effect. The use of black and grey ink adds to the tattoo’s dramatic impact. For realism tattoos, it’s crucial to find an artist with a strong understanding of anatomy and shading principles.

Symbolism and Cultural Significance

The Ouroboros is an ancient symbol found in various cultures, including Egyptian, Greek, and Norse mythology. It represents the cyclical nature of life, death, and rebirth, as well as the concept of eternity and wholeness. The serpent symbolizes transformation and renewal.
